Manhattan School of Music vs. SUNY Delhi

Both Manhattan School of Music and SUNY College of Technology at Delhi are 4 years schools located in New York. The following statements compare Manhattan School of Music and SUNY College of Technology at Delhi with important academic statistics including tuition, test scores, and admission rate.
  • Manhattan School of Music's tuition ($54,600) is more expensive than SUNY Delhi ($12,480).
  • Manhattan School of Music's acceptance rate (39.94%) is lower than SUNY Delhi (88.41%).
  • Manhattan School of Music has higher yield (24.83%) than SUNY Delhi (15.77%).
  • Manhattan School of Music's students to faculty ratio (6 to 1) is lower than SUNY Delhi (12 to 1).
  • SUNY Delhi (2,777 students) is larger than Manhattan School of Music (1,097 students) with more enrolled students.
  • Manhattan School of Music ($25,243) has higher amount of financial aid than SUNY Delhi ($8,665).
  • Manhattan School of Music's graduation rate (78%) is higher than SUNY Delhi (48%).
